Perfectly positioned on one of Beekman Place's picturesque, tree-lined blocks, Residence 8D is a stunning example of prewar elegance in one of the neighborhood's premier white-glove cooperatives. This beautiful two-bedroom, two-bathroom home seamlessly blends timeless architectural charm with modern comforts.

The gracious living room, highlighted by Custom Louis XV-style cherry wood paneling and cabinetry, classic beamed ceilings, which offers an inviting setting for both relaxing and entertaining, with ample space for a dining area. The spacious primary suite includes a dressing area, abundant closet space, and windowed bathroom. The versatile second bedroom features custom built-ins and an en-suite bath, making it equally suited as a guest bedroom, home office, or library.

Additional prewar details-include a welcoming entrance gallery, elegant moldings, graceful, curved walls, and arched doorways-lend warmth, character, and architectural distinction throughout the home.

Architectural Woodwork, Furnishings & Windows

Custom Louis XV-style cherry wood paneling and cabinetry were handcrafted between 1972-1974 by Serafin Caamano of Budd Woodwork, Inc., Brooklyn, a fifth-generation master craftsman also commissioned by the Metropolitan Museum of Art. The paneling was hand-waxed and buffed in 1999, preserving its rich patina.

Louis XV-style furnishings; which are available for sale, were commissioned from Don Ruseau, Inc. and acquired in 1974. Established in 1937, the firm was known for refined French Louis XV reproductions in French walnut, distinguished by hand-carved detailing and elegant proportions.

In December 2018, windows were replaced by Skyline Windows with Series 100 AAMA DH-AW-50 double-hung units featuring thermally broken frames, tilt-in operation, triple weather-stripping, Ultra-Lift balances, and 1-inch Low-E argon-filled insulated glass, finished in white interiors and dark bronze exteriors. Bedroom and living room windows include laminated safety glass for enhanced sound attenuation and security, with Marvin primed pine interiors and aluminum exterior glazing beads preserving the original configuration. Scope included the bedroom, library, living room, and both bathrooms; kitchen windows were previously replaced as part of a building-wide upgrade.
